If you run a full scan with Microsoft Safety Scanner, it will remediate any malware that
Defender is alerting you to. Since they both use the same definitions for defining malware.
The Scanner removes the need for you to locate and delete the malware. The problem
that is bothering you, is caused by Defender re-detecting the malware, that is present in
its history file. That is the real problem. And the reason for deleting the Detection History.
After a full scan, using the Microsoft Safety Scanner, then you need to follow the instructions
for deleting Detection History, that are on page one of this thread. I will repeat the procedure
here for clarity.
- Open File Explorer and click on the "View" tab. Find "Hidden Items" and check its box.
- Navigate through File Explorer using this path.
>OS (C:) >ProgramData >Microsoft >Windows Defender >Scans (Note: You may have
to click on "Continue" on the popup, if it appears) >History >Serviceand delete the folder
Detection History. Close File Explorer and Restart your PC.
Defender should no longer alert you to the malware. It may be necessary to repeat this
procedure, if/when, you contract anymore malware in the future.
